Actually, we make homemade mochas at our house, and we do it like this: stir together 1 tsp cocoa powder, 1 tsp instant coffee, 2 tsp sugar (incidentally, all those teaspoons are generous ones) and a dash of salt in a mug, then add a bit of water and stir to make a paste. Heat this in the microwave for 10 seconds–this step makes it easy to stir in milk. Add (skim) milk to fill mug and heat 1 – 1.5 minutes.
